Caption: Figure 1.

Phase coverage of the observing epochs. With the three epochs, we fully cover phases of 0.34 through 0.63. The two CRIRES+ epochs are newly presented in this paper, while the IGRINS epoch was first presented in Y. Shu et al. (2026). The gray region represents the time when CoRoT-2 b is in eclipse, while the black dashed line shows the phase where CoRoT-2 b has its maximum brightness based on the observed Spitzer phase curves. Our observations cover the time of peak expected brightness with about 3 hr of baseline continuing afterward.
